Why Invest in a Wine Refrigerator?
A wine refrigerator, also known as a wine cooler, maintains a consistent temperature and humidity level, which is essential for preserving the stability of your wine. Unlike standard refrigerators, wine coolers are particularly created to house wine and typically provide optimal storage conditions, including UV protection, vibration control, and correct shelving.

What to Look for in a Small Wine Refrigerator
Before diving into our suggestions, it's vital to understand what to try to find when selecting the best small wine refrigerator for your needs:
- Capacity: Determine how numerous bottles you plan to shop.
- Temperature Zones: Single-zone vs. dual-zone coolers deal with various kinds of red wines.
- Size and Design: Measure offered space and choose a style that fits your décor.
- Cooling Technology: Decide between compressor-based and thermoelectric designs.
- Price: Set a budget plan and discover a model that offers the very best worth for your cash.
